Answer:

58.03 ft

Explanation:

To solve for the total circumference of circle F, we can create a ratio of section angle measure to circumference. We know that these two attributes of a circle have a linear relationship because the formula for arc length (
S = 2\pi r \cdot (\theta)/(360\°)) relies proportionately on the radius and angle measure of the section.

angle measure : circumference

290° : 46.75 ft

We can multiply this ratio by
(360)/(290) to get the corresponding circumference for a 360° section (which is the entire circle).


(360)/(290)(290\° : 46.75 \text{ ft})


= 360\° : \boxed{58.03 \text{ ft}}

Therefore, the circumference of circle F is approximately 58.03 ft.
